Ensuring Thorough Cleaning of High-Touch Areas
Keeping high-touch surfaces consistently clean is critical for maintaining a healthy and professional environment. These surfaces include door handles, light switches, elevator buttons, reception counters, conference room tables, and any spots that see frequent contact throughout the workday. In many office cleaning routines, these areas can be overlooked if they are not specifically identified and included in a cleaning checklist. However, thorough attention to these frequently used items can significantly reduce the spread of germs and create a more welcoming space for employees and visitors.
A structured, safety-forward approach to high-touch area cleaning typically begins with selecting safe, effective disinfectants that meet recognized standards. This can include medical-grade wipes or industry-approved solutions designed to neutralize common pathogens. Pairing your chosen disinfectant with color-coded microfiber cloths or disposable wipes helps minimize cross-contamination between different surfaces. For example, using one cloth color for doorknobs and another for desktops ensures that bacteria are not inadvertently spread from one area to another.
Consistency is also key. Scheduling regular wipe-downs of high-touch surfaces throughout the day, or at least once per cleaning shift, adds an extra layer of protection. Many commercial cleaning teams integrate follow-up checks to confirm that these tasks are completed thoroughly. Combined with a wider office cleaning protocol, a targeted focus on high-traffic surfaces helps prevent minor oversights from escalating into bigger cleanliness or health concerns.
